i ve been working on a map for a while
suddenly after compiling
when i start the map i get this error :


Error during initialization:
G_ModelIndex: overflow

i assume this means i have too many models on my map
i have already deleted many
but am still getting that error

any ideas?

i had this error too, it has to do with the total number of different models you use, i believe the cod2 engine can only handle 256 different models at a time. so remove some models which appaer only a couple times from your map and recompile
